Output ebf7a91e616ea9f23008181d5e177d94fa86d3bc46811883b47756c843f9b55a:0

value
155939032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9888018190e9f30ab270269b90f1a1837da00cc2 OP_EQUAL
address
3FbXZZE2n1AZwDqfKa6DXLeei9raU9xQL1
transaction
ebf7a91e616ea9f23008181d5e177d94fa86d3bc46811883b47756c843f9b55a
spent
true